Is the Barber School Accredited? It's necessary to make certain that the barber school you pick is accredited. The accreditation should be by a U.S. Department of Education certified local or national organization, such as the National Accrediting Commission for Cosmetology Arts & Sciences (NACCAS). Schools accredited by the NACCAS must comply with their high standards assuring a quality curriculum and education. Accreditation may also be important for getting student loans or financial aid, which typically are not obtainable in Norwalk CA for non- accredited schools. It's also a criteria for licensing in many states that the training be accredited. And as a final benefit, many employers will not recruit recent graduates of non-accredited schools, or may look more favorably upon those with accredited training.

Is Plenty of Hands-On Training Provided?  Practicing and mastering barbering techniques and abilities requires lots of practice on people. Ask how much live, hands-on training is provided in the barber courses you will be attending. A number of schools have shops on site that make it possible for students to practice their growing talents on real people. If a Norwalk CA barber school offers little or no scheduled live training, but rather depends mainly on utilizing mannequins, it might not be the most effective alternative for developing your skills. So search for other schools that offer this type of training.

Is Financial Aid Offered?  Many barber schools offer financial aid or student loan assistance for their students. Find out if the schools you are investigating have a financial aid office. Talk to a counselor and identify what student loans or grants you might get approved for. If the school belongs to the American Association of Cosmetology Schools (AACS), it will have scholarships available to students as well. If a school meets all of your other qualifications with the exception of cost, do not omit it as an alternative before you learn what financial help may be provided in Norwalk CA.
